Originally Posted by Wilky
My KM2's (in 33-inch) were at 43K when Dennis picked them up. He can atest to how much tread remained. There was enough to DEF rock crawl/wheel...and still get another 10K highway on them. The longevity was amazing and if BFG were sized true then I would have gotten them again (a 35 measured out short). Be sure to check your rating though, as they were bouncy being an E-rated tire.
I'm not sure it was the tires as it was the lift I got from you. That skyjacker lift is bouncy as hell. Of course I am needing shocks.

I dislike short tires. Recommend me a 35x12.50x17 Or hell even a 36" tire. I'm going to chop my flairs so I am really debating 37's but I think that will call for a regear.
